Suriname national assembly votes in Santokhi as new president - Stabroek News

Paramaribo,  (Reuters) - Suriname's National Assembly voted in former justice minister Chan Santokhi as its new president today, ending the rule of former strongman Desi Bouterse, who had dominated the country's politics in recent decades.
